KITCHEN 3RD WEEK




This week we found ourselves getting burn - out and the slow pace is getting to us....but we forged on and finished our island except for tile and one leg lol but it is comming along, this week we just had to buy more plywood and cement board and some trim we finished installing our oven its facing the frig which is a little too close but we had to hide the floor( missing piece) we only had a couple of pieces to fix the whole as we cannot find the same flooring. Our biggest problem is what color grout to use on our backsplash white grey or dark brown.....we want it to look old so we shall see. I am happy so far but ready to have it done the weather was too nice to be inside this weekend. Ro

KITCHEN 2nd week


Well we spent 450.00 on unfinished cabinets for our island this payday and 300.00 on a new oven off craigs list...gotta love craigs list ! last week. oh and I also bought my sink this weekend...
So for alot of impact we have spent very little money so far and we don't plan to spend alot on this project. we spent 200.00 on marble tiles for our bar and counter that we moved. we puchased the tiles the beadboard and the wonderboard grout and mortor last weekend.This weekend we plan to tile and stain the cabinets for the Island and frame in for our oven and then put the plywood on and the wonderboard on the island. next week we hope to order more tile. Hopefully this weekend was our biggest expense for this project. I will post pics later. so I can do before and after. Ro

OUR KITCHEN




OUR KITCHEN .... is the first project on the house. When we purchased the house it had been on the market for quite some time and it was apparent why for two reasons I believe. One, the kitchen is attached to a living room that was at the back of the house and was almost like walking into a surprise room although nice size it was like it had been added onto. As you walked into the kitchen from the dinning area through a regular doorway, and then surprise wow ppl would say this is nice but when you walk into the house it looks so small because all you see is this family room and dinning room. Plus the refrigerator was standing alone on the wall between the dinning room and kitchen as an after thought i guess). The second reason was because there is a deck off the back of the house overlooking the property and the stairs are very precarious. I could see past this however and new they were easy fixes.
So we have no money and no time my husband works out of town and is home thurs evenings fri sat and sun. so with no budget we took out a wall made it a half wall and swung the excisting cabinets around to set against the wall here are some pics.....Ro
